Unilever employees with the support of Flora run the world's most beautiful marathon in aid of Thokomala!
Over Easter weekend 2012, Paul Polman, Unilever's global Chairman, Doug Bailey, Gail Klintworth and other international Unilever top managers will descend upon Cape Town to run the Two Oceans marathon to raise funds for Thokomala.
The South African Chairman, Marijn van Tiggelen plus a number of Unilever's 2011 Comrades runners will join the global executives. All the runners will reach out to their family, friends and business contacts to raise as much money as possible for Thokomala.
This link will take you to the Givengain Foundation's website, which facilitates donations for Thokomala. Each runner is loaded as an "activist" and can point his or her supporters to their webpage for pledges and messages of support.
Flora is issuing every runner with a branded race kit.
Easter weekend 2012 is a repeat of Thokomala's initial founding drive when Niall FitzGerald,
then Unilever's global Chairman and Doug Baillie, then Unilever South Africa's Chairman ran the New York Marathon and raised R1m to get Thokomala started!
